CALCULATING OF RELIABILITY PARAMETERS OF MICROELECTRONIC COMPONENTS AND ...
By: Palagin et al. (4065 reads)
Rating: (1.00/10)

Abstract: Today together with actual designing and tests it is often used virtual methods of designing, which support prior calculations of parameters of the developed devices. Such parameters include reliability. For this purpose the virtual laboratory for computer-aided design, which is developed during joint project by V.M. Glushkov Institute of Cybernetics of NAS of Ukraine and Institute of Mathematics and Informatics of BAS, contains program unit for calculating reliability parameters of separate microelectronic components and whole devices. The program unit work is based on two computing method: the first one uses exponential distribution of failure probability and the second one – DN-distribution of failure probability. Presence of theoretical materials, computing methods description and other background materials lets to use this program unit not only for designing and scientific researches, but also in education process.
